Speed Sensor Assembly should be aligned with magnet and
connected to data cable. Realign sensor if necessary. Replace
if there is any damage to the sensor or the connecting wire.
Contact Customer Care for further assistance.
Levelers may be turned to level machine.
Adjustment may not be able to compensate for extremely un-
even surfaces. Move machine to level area.
Pedal should be tightened securely to crank arm. Be sure con-
nection is not cross-threaded.
Crank arm should be tightened securely to axle.
Refer to the "Adjust the Belt Tension" procedure in the Service
Manual.
Remove pedals. Make sure there is no debris on threads, and
reinstall the pedals.
Be sure adjustment pin is locked into one of the seat post
adjustment holes.
Be sure knob is securely tightened.
